After Franco Cassina established Nemo in Milan in 1993, the company was acquired by Federico Palazzari in 2012 and now offers a unique selection of lamps designed by twentieth century design masters such as Le Corbusier, Charlotte Perriand, Vico Magistretti, Franco Albini and Kazuhide Takahama. The company also collaborates with designers such as Mario Bellini, Jean Nouvel, Andrea Branzi, Bernhard Osann and Arihiro Miyake. In 2020, Nemo Studio was born after the acquisition of Turin-based lighting company Ilti Luce. Nemo produces innovative solutions for architectural lighting design for museums, retail stores and outdoor applications and has a distribution network in more than 40 countries.
